Poor hit hardest hit by fuel hike

Reading Time: < 1 minute

South Africans will be hard hit financially with the latest fuel hike.

Economist says the poorest of the poor will be hardest affected.

Motorists are urged to fill up their tanks before fuel price increase.

The price of petrol and diesel will increase by around 26 cents a litre, paraffin by 22 cents a litre and LP-Gas by 37 cents a kilogram.

Economist Dawie Roodt says the next couple of months are going to be tough.

“As always, it’s going to be the poor that are affected. The poor typically cannot hedge themselves against price increases unlike richer people and therefore the impact of these price increases will mostly be felt by the poor. This will also create a situation where the Reserve Bank will have to increase interest rates in order to force inflation down.”
